Fifty Fifty’s ‘After-School Exorcism Club,’ The Boyz’s ‘Wi-Fi Love in the Palace’ and NCT’s ‘Wind Up: The Movie’ Score New Asia Sales for Finecut
South Korean sales company Finecut has landed new territorial deals for two K-pop idol-fronted theatrical titles, “After-School Exorcism Club: Girls’ Night” and “Wi-Fi Love in the Palace,” while also adding fresh markets for the previously sold “Wind Up: The Movie.” “After-School Exorcism Club: Girls’ Night” has gone to Indonesia (Catchplay+), Singapore (Shaw Organisation) and Taiwan […]
